Monkey island
Monkey Island, also known as Isla de los Monos, is a popular tourist destination in Panama. It is located in Lake Gatun, which is part of the Panama Canal system. This island is home to several species of monkeys, including capuchins, howlers, and tamarins, among others. Panama City is the capital and largest city of Panama, located at the Pacific entrance of the Panama Canal. It’s a vibrant metropolis known for its modern skyline, historic Casco Viejo district (Old Panama City), and its role as a financial hub in Central America. The city boasts a mix of colonial architecture and sleek skyscrapers, offering a contrast of old and new. Panama City is also renowned for its biodiversity and nearby natural attractions, including tropical rainforests and beautiful beaches along the Pacific coast.
